Computer Lab at the Cambodia University of Management and Technology (CUMT) under the auspices of a Singapore philanthropist through the Emaan Cambodia Foundation, it was officially launched.

Phnom Penh: The Cambodia University of Management and Technology (CUMT) on July 2, 2023, organized the inauguration ceremony of EMAAN COMPUTER LAB, which was supported by the Imaan Foundation Cambodia, equipped with computers and equipment total budget of about $ 34,500.

The event was attended by H.E Dr. Hosen Mohamad Farid, Chairman of the Board of The Cambodia University of Management and Technology (CUMT), H.E Dr. Sles Nazy, Rector, Mr. Haji Mohamad Kahliab, President of the Eman Foundation of Singapore, and the accompanying delegation, Academic staff and students of CUMT University.

His Excellency Dr. Sles Nazy, Rector of CUMT University, said that the support received from the Eman Foundation today is very important to complete the need for technical equipment to be used for the practical implementation for all students those who are studying basic classes in computer science.

In addition, H.E Dr. Hosen Mohamad Farid, Chairman of the Board of the Cambodia University of Management and Technology (CUMT) expressed his pleasure and gratitude to the Eman Foundation, especially Mr. Haji Mohd Kahliab, President of the Eman Foundation of Singapore for his cooperation and provide auspices University for needy students Opportunity to expand knowledge on technology. He also requested that the Eman Foundation continue to cooperate in the development of the university in terms of materials and curriculum.

On that occasion, Haji Mohd Kahliab, President of the Eman Foundation of Singapore, urged all students to help maintain these computers for long-term use and encourage students to study hard for the benefit of society in the future. He also thanked all the benefactors who participated in this project. And he will examine the possibility of helping as much as possible by joining the university in training and capacity building for students through other educational programs.

It should be noted that in addition to supporting the organization of computer labs now, The Eman Foundation also donated 10 laptops to students with disabilities to use in their studies.
